Fragrance Firms Hit Across Europe in Scent Supply Cartel Probe

March 8, 2023, 9:44 AM UTC

Fragrance firms across Europe risk potentially hefty fines after prosecutor raids over concerns companies including Givaudan SA and Symrise AG colluded over price to supply scents and ingredients.

The European Commission carried out the unannounced inspections at the premises of Givaudan, Symrise as well as International Flavors & Fragrances Inc. and Firmenich International SA, whose scents and ingredients are used in household and personal care products.

Swiss, UK and US regulators were involved in the raids and also “sent out formal requests for information to several companies active in the same sector.”
